jHipster features and specs

  • Rapid Development
    jHipster accelerates the development process by generating a full application stack with a frontend, backend, and necessary configurations in a matter of minutes.
  • Wide Technology Stack
    It supports a variety of modern technologies including Spring Boot, Angular, React, and Vue, giving developers flexibility in their tech choices.
  • Best Practices
    The generated code follows industry best practices for security, scalability, and maintainability, reducing the risk of common pitfalls.
  • Microservices Support
    jHipster provides robust support for microservices architectures, including service discovery, API gateway, and containerization.
  • Active Community
    jHipster has a large and active community which means frequent updates, rich documentation, and abundant third-party tutorials and plugins.
  • Customization
    The generated code is highly customizable, allowing developers to easily modify and extend the generated boilerplate to fit their specific requirements.
  • Integrated Tooling
    It comes with integrated tools like JUnit for testing, Liquibase for database versioning, and Maven/Gradle for build automation.

Possible disadvantages of jHipster

  • Learning Curve
    For developers unfamiliar with the technologies used by jHipster, there can be a steep learning curve before getting productive.
  • Complexity
    The generated applications can be complex, making it harder to understand and maintain the codebase, especially for small projects or teams.
  • Dependency Management
    Managing the numerous dependencies that come with a jHipster project can become cumbersome, leading to potential version conflicts.
  • Overhead
    The inclusion of many features by default can introduce unnecessary overhead, potentially impacting performance and resource usage.
  • Customization Effort
    While customization is possible, it may require significant effort to deviate from the standard patterns and configurations provided by jHipster.
  • Tooling Fragmentation
    Using a wide array of tools and libraries can create fragmentation, leading to challenges in unified project management and deployment.
